What to Consider When Choosing a WordPress Hosting Provider

But before we dive into each hosting provider specifically let’s look at key factors to consider when choosing a WordPress hosting:

  • Performance: SEO and user engagement depend significantly on how fast your website loads. Go for providers that have powerful servers, SSD storage, and Content Delivery Networks (CDNs) that will optimize their loading speed.
  • Security: Consider providers who offer things such as malware scans once in a while, SSL certificates automatically enabled on all your sites, and firewalls that protect your site against hackers.
  • Scalability: Choose a provider that allows room for growth since as you advance your site’s capacity grows too. With increased traffic and data storage requirements, look out for hosts who have upgrade options
  • Uptime: Providers should be able to guarantee high uptime figures so that visitors can always access your website.
  • Customer Support: Essential for troubleshooting any technical issues customers may face; therefore reliable customer service must be available
  • Ease of Use: This point depends on one’s level of skills plus experience in technology. There are those designed for beginners using drag-and-drop builders while others focus more on those with advanced skills.
  • Pricing: Going through budget-friendly up to luxurious offers depending upon what a particular user wants from his/ her site- this will determine which plan he/ she goes along with finally regarding the price range paid towards it.

1. Bluehost

Bluehost is known throughout the industry as an old player offering beginner-friendly and advanced WordPress-specific hosting solutions. For both seasoned developers or newcomers looking forward to launching their online presence, it is a perfect platform. Bluehost’s website management is simplified by one-click WordPress installation, free domain registration and around the clock support service.

Features:

  • Bluehost provides many features including SSD storage, free SSL certificates, automated WordPress updates and more secure systems like SiteLock security and CodeGuard back-ups.

Performance:

  • High uptime levels and super-fast load times are key goals of Bluehost that uses modern infrastructure powered by SSD servers, Cloudflare CDN integration as well as resource protection.

Pricing:

  • Starting from just $2.95 per month for shared hosting, Bluehost has one of the lowest price points in the industry making it affordable to those who have budget constraints. Additionally, they offer scaling options for growing websites or e-commerce stores.

Pros and Cons:

  • Pros: User-friendly interface, reliable performance, affordable rates.
  • Cons: Limited storage on entry-level plans, upselling tactics during checkout.

2. SiteGround

SiteGround is a commonly known provider best for its outstanding performance, advanced security features as well as superior customer services. Designed for small businesses up to enterprise level customers; Site Ground has managed WP hosting solutions that guarantee fast speed and high safety levels in their sites.

Features:

  • SiteGround offers a range of features such as SSD storage, free SSL certificates, daily backups with built-in staging environments and caching technology used to enhance website performance.

Performance:

  • SiteGround boasts about its industry-leading availability scores that result from optimized server infrastructures; operating NGINX servers; PHP 7.x support plus proactive monitoring of servers.

Pricing:

  • The StartUp plan costs $6.99 per month which includes essential features (one site hosted), while other plans give you more resources at affordable prices.

Pros and Cons:

  • Pros: Great results on performance testing when compared against other providers; they also provide excellent customer service;
  • Cons: Only limited initial storage space; Expensive after first year

Top 10 WordPress Hosting Providers in 2024: Key Comparison

Provider Storage Free SSL Backups Customer Support Performance Price (Starting)
Bluehost Varies Yes Automatic 24/7 High Uptime, SSD Storage $2.95
SiteGround 10GB Yes Daily 24/7 Excellent, NGINX Servers $6.99
HostGator Unlimited Yes Optional 24/7 Reliable, 99.9% Uptime $2.75
DreamHost Unlimited Yes Automated 24/7 Good, SSD Storage $2.59
WP Engine 10GB Yes Managed WordPress Experts Top-Tier, Scalable $25
A2 Hosting Unlimited Yes Optional 24/7 High Speed, Turbo Servers $2.99
InMotion Hosting Unlimited Yes Automatic 24/7 Reliable, Uptime Guarantee $6.99
Hostinger 10GB Yes Weekly 24/7 Live Chat Good, Optimized Servers $0.99
GreenBeginner Unlimited Yes Nightly 24/7 Good, Eco-Friendly Hosting $2.95
Site5 Unlimited Yes Automatic 24/7 Reliable, Scalable Plans $6.95
